Property Details for 4/18 Jellicoe St, Coorparoo

4/18 Jellicoe St, Coorparoo is a 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1992. The property has a land size of 131m2 and floor size of 80m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in July 2025.

About Coorparoo 4151

The size of Coorparoo is approximately 5.4 square kilometres. There are 31 parks, covering nearly 10.1% of the total area. The population of Coorparoo in 2016 was 16282 people. By 2021 the population was 18132 showing a population growth of 11.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Coorparoo is 20-29 years. Households in Coorparoo are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Coorparoo work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 52.30% of the homes in Coorparoo were owner-occupied compared with 52.10% in 2016.

Coorparoo has 9,956 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Coorparoo have seen a 60.59%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 106.30%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Coorparoo is $1,946,267 while the median value for Units is $912,466.
  • Houses have a median rent of $820 while Units have a median rent of $650.
There are currently 34 properties listed for sale, and 28 properties listed for rent in Coorparoo on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 386 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Coorparoo.
